Weather Alert: Showers or thundershowers expected later today

Date:

The Department of Meteorology in Sri Lanka has warned that several parts of the island can expect showers or thundershowers after 2.00 p.m. The warning indicates that the Western, Sabaragamuwa, and North-western provinces, as well as the Galle and Matara districts, are likely to experience fairly heavy showers of over 75 mm. Showers may also occur in the Eastern province and southern coastal areas during the morning hours.

The Department has advised the public to take adequate precautions to minimize damages caused by temporary localized strong winds and lightning during thundershowers.

The sea areas around the island will also experience showers or thundershowers in several places. Wind speeds will be south-easterly to easterly around the island, with a speed of 20-30 kmph. The sea areas around the island will be slight to moderate. However, the Department has warned that temporarily strong gusty winds and very rough seas can be expected during thundershowers.

The weather warning is expected to remain in place for several hours and residents are advised to monitor the weather updates from the Department of Meteorology.
